In ΔPQR, right angled at Q, PR + QR = 25 cm and PQ = 5 cm. Determine the values of sin P, cos P and tan P.

Given that, PR + QR = 25
PQ = 5
Let PR be x.
Therefore, QR = 25 − x

Applying Pythagoras theorem in ΔPQR, we obtain
PR2 = PQ2 + QR2
x2 = (5)2 + (25 − x)2
x2 = 25 + 625 + x2 − 50x
50x = 650
x = 13
Therefore, PR = 13 cm
QR = (25 − 13) cm
= 12 cm
sin P = `("QR")/("PR")=12/13`
cos P = `("PQ")/("PR")=5/13`
tan P = `("QR")/("PQ")=12/5`
